check the spark plug it could be oiled up or sooty thus giving a weak spark
 
Yeah, car oil has additional slip properties which are no good to the wet clutches, if you do use car oil eventually you will get clutch slip.
 
Give HT lead/s a spray with WD40 and it won't harm to give electrics a spray whilst you're doing it. Can't remember what oil I used in my 'blade, know it was Castrol and cost about £28 for 4 litres. Also check fuel line or filter, could be clogged.
